How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dexter?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Dexter Studio Apartments | $2,059 | $1,125 | $2,947 |
Dexter 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,137 | $1,037 | $3,950 |
Dexter 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,608 | $1,212 | $4,995 |
Dexter 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,599 | $1,320 | $4,145 |
Dexter 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,285 | $999 | $1,719 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
